What will I learn?

MSc Finance is the flagship Masters degree of our finance disciplines at Essex Business School. It delivers a solid base in finance for those with a strong quantitative and financial background who wish to move into a career in the finance sector.This Masters in finance has been developed to meet the needs of a global finance sector that is still partially in recovery and in need of decisive leadership and new thinking. You will learn using case studies, almost real-time data from our Bloomberg data feed and established financial models. You will learn when and what to question and how you and your unique skillset can make an impact.MSc Finance provides you with the foundation for a rewarding career in banking and finance, equipping you with the skills to lead at a global level.Our graduates enjoy careers in financial analysis, management, public administration and accountancy at some of the world’s most well-known organisations and exciting SMEs, including:KPMG, Grant Thornton LLP, Inter-American Development Bank,European Central Bank

Entry requirements

For international students

A 2:2 degree, or international equivalent, in one of the following subjects (with no module requirements): Business / Commerce, Computer Science, Economics, Engineering, Mathematics, Natural Science, Data Analysis, Statistics or we will also consider applicants who hold a CFA Institute Programme Level One, Two or Three (pass or above).
